Mr. Bush stated in an interview, "I felt like both sides ought to be properly taught." – Evolution vs. Intelligent Design – One a scientific theory and the other is a controversial declaration that features in the universe such as life are best explained as ID (Intelligent Design). ID doesn’t necessarily point the finger at God as being the mastermind behind life on earth and possibly elsewhere, however most advocates of ID believe that the so-called “Designer” is God or some intelligent life form such as aliens.
